背景技术Background technique

石灰石是常见的建筑材料,为了方便石灰石的后续使用和加工,需要对石灰石进行破碎。目前常见的石灰石加工用破碎装置一般都只是单纯的具有破碎的功能,并不具备筛选的功能,导致不能够将合格的石灰石和不合格的石灰石区分开,为此,本方案提出了一种石灰石加工用破碎设备。Limestone is a common building material. In order to facilitate the subsequent use and processing of limestone, it needs to be crushed. At present, the common crushing devices for limestone processing generally only have the function of crushing and do not have the function of screening, which makes it impossible to distinguish the qualified limestone from the unqualified limestone. Therefore, this scheme proposes a limestone Crushing equipment for processing.

参照图1-5,一种石灰石加工用破碎设备,包括破碎箱1,破碎箱1的顶部固定有破碎斗4,破碎斗4的顶部固定有进料斗2,破碎斗4的内部转动连接有两个破碎辊3,破碎箱1的顶部固定有电机21,两个破碎辊3的一端均固定有转轴19,两个转轴19的一端均延伸至破碎斗4的外部,两个转轴19的外部均固定有齿轮20,两个齿轮20相啮合,电机21的输出轴的一端与其中一个转轴19传动连接(见图1和图5);通过电机21和两个齿轮20之间的配合,可以利用一个电机21来带动两个破碎辊3转动,破碎箱1的内部设有振动板7,振动板7的顶部两侧均固定有侧板6,振动板7上开设有筛选口,筛选口的内部镶嵌有筛网10,破碎箱1的一侧开设有分选口12,振动板7的一端延伸至分选口12的内部与分选口12转动连接,振动板7的两侧均开设有连接孔16,两个连接孔16均位于分选口12的内部,破碎箱1的两侧均螺纹连接有螺栓15,两个螺栓15的一端分别延伸至两个连接孔16的内部,两个螺栓15位于两个连接孔16内部的一端均固定有固定柱22,固定柱22与连接孔16转动连接(见图1和图3);通过螺栓15的设置,方便了振动板7与分选口12之间的拆分,固定柱22的设置可以避免螺栓15的螺纹对连接孔16造成损坏。1-5, a crushing equipment for limestone processing includes a crushing box 1, a crushing bucket 4 is fixed on the top of the crushing box 1, a feeding hopper 2 is fixed on the top of the crushing bucket 4, and the interior of the crushing bucket 4 is rotatably connected with Two crushing rollers 3, a motor 21 is fixed on the top of the crushing box 1, one end of the two crushing rollers 3 is fixed with a rotating shaft 19, one end of the two rotating shafts 19 extends to the outside of the crushing bucket 4, and the outside of the two rotating shafts 19 is Both gears 20 are fixed, the two gears 20 are meshed, and one end of the output shaft of the motor 21 is connected with one of the rotating shafts 19 (see Figures 1 and 5); through the cooperation between the motor 21 and the two gears 20, the A motor 21 is used to drive the two crushing rollers 3 to rotate, a vibrating plate 7 is provided inside the crushing box 1, side plates 6 are fixed on both sides of the top of the vibrating plate 7, and a screening port is provided on the vibrating plate 7. A screen 10 is embedded inside, a sorting port 12 is opened on one side of the crushing box 1, one end of the vibrating plate 7 extends to the interior of the sorting port 12 and is rotatably connected with the sorting port 12, and both sides of the vibrating plate 7 are provided with Connecting holes 16, the two connecting holes 16 are both located inside the sorting port 12, bolts 15 are threaded on both sides of the crushing box 1, and one end of the two bolts 15 respectively extends to the inside of the two connecting holes 16, and the two One end of the bolt 15 located inside the two connecting holes 16 is fixed with a fixing column 22, and the fixing column 22 is rotatably connected with the connecting hole 16 (see Figures 1 and 3); the arrangement of the bolts 15 facilitates the vibration plate 7 and the sorting The disassembly between the ports 12 and the arrangement of the fixing posts 22 can prevent the threads of the bolts 15 from causing damage to the connecting holes 16 .

分选口12的底部固定有接料板13,接料板13的一端延伸至破碎箱1的外部,接料板13倾斜设置,接料板13的宽度与分选口12的宽度相同,接料板13的顶部两侧均固定有挡板11(见图1-2);挡板11的设置可以避免石灰石从接料板13的两侧掉落,破碎箱1远离分选口12的一侧内壁上固定有固定板8,振动板7的底部固定有震动电机5,振动板7的底部一侧固定有缓冲柱14,缓冲柱14的底部贯穿固定板8延伸至固定板8的下方,缓冲柱14的底部固定有限位板9,缓冲柱14的外部套设有两个弹簧,两个弹簧分别位于固定板8的顶部和底部,破碎箱1的底部开设有出料口,破碎箱1的底部固定有四个支脚(见图1-3);破碎后的物料掉落在振动板7上,震动电机5带动振动板7震动,使得粒径小的石灰石从筛网10中穿过,最后从出料口排出,而粒径大的石灰石则从分选口12排出,等待二次破碎。The bottom of the sorting port 12 is fixed with a feeding plate 13, one end of the feeding plate 13 extends to the outside of the crushing box 1, the feeding plate 13 is inclined, and the width of the feeding plate 13 is the same as that of the sorting port 12. Baffles 11 are fixed on both sides of the top of the material plate 13 (see Figure 1-2); the setting of the baffles 11 can prevent the limestone from falling from both sides of the material receiving plate 13, and the crushing box 1 is far away from a part of the sorting port 12. A fixed plate 8 is fixed on the side inner wall, a vibration motor 5 is fixed at the bottom of the vibration plate 7, a buffer column 14 is fixed on one side of the bottom of the vibration plate 7, and the bottom of the buffer column 14 extends through the fixed plate 8 to the bottom of the fixed plate 8, The bottom of the buffer column 14 is fixed with a limiting plate 9, and the outside of the buffer column 14 is sleeved with two springs, which are located at the top and bottom of the fixed plate 8 respectively. Four feet are fixed at the bottom of the screen (see Figure 1-3); the crushed material falls on the vibrating plate 7, and the vibration motor 5 drives the vibrating plate 7 to vibrate, so that the limestone with small particle size passes through the screen 10, Finally, it is discharged from the discharge port, and the limestone with large particle size is discharged from the sorting port 12, waiting for secondary crushing.

具体的,破碎箱1的一侧开设有缺口,缺口的外部铰接有密封门17,密封门17的一侧固定有固定块18,固定块18与破碎箱1的外壁之间通过螺钉固定(见图4);在筛网10需要清理或者检修的时候,将密封门17打开,将限位板9从缓冲柱14上拆下,然后将振动板7从破碎箱1的缺口拿出来,然后就可以对筛网10进行清理。Specifically, one side of the crushing box 1 is provided with a gap, the outside of the gap is hinged with a sealing door 17, one side of the sealing door 17 is fixed with a fixing block 18, and the fixing block 18 and the outer wall of the crushing box 1 are fixed by screws (see Figure 4); when the screen 10 needs to be cleaned or repaired, open the sealing door 17, remove the limit plate 9 from the buffer column 14, and then take out the vibration plate 7 from the notch of the crushing box 1, and then The screen 10 can be cleaned.

破碎石灰石时,启动电机21和震动电机5,电机21带动开两个破碎辊3转动,物料从进料斗2进入到破碎斗4的内部被破碎辊3破碎,破碎后的物料掉落在振动板7上,震动电机5带动振动板7震动,两个弹簧在震动电机5的作用下不断压缩和回复原状,振动板7围绕两个固定柱22转动,从而保证正振动板7可以上下震动,使得粒径小的石灰石从筛网10中穿过,最后从出料口排出,而粒径大的石灰石则从分选口12排出,落在接料板13上,排出后等待二次破碎,当筛网10需要进行清理的时候,可以先将密封门17打开,然后将两个螺栓15拧下,最后再将限位板9从缓冲柱14上拆下,然后将振动板7从破碎箱1的缺口拿出来,然后就可以对筛网10进行清理。When crushing limestone, start the motor 21 and the vibration motor 5, the motor 21 drives the two crushing rollers 3 to rotate, the material enters the crushing bucket 4 from the feeding hopper 2 and is crushed by the crushing roller 3, and the crushed material falls into the vibration. On the plate 7, the vibration motor 5 drives the vibration plate 7 to vibrate, the two springs are continuously compressed and restored to the original state under the action of the vibration motor 5, and the vibration plate 7 rotates around the two fixed columns 22, thereby ensuring that the positive vibration plate 7 can vibrate up and down, The limestone with small particle size passes through the screen 10 and is finally discharged from the discharge port, while the limestone with large particle size is discharged from the sorting port 12 and falls on the receiving plate 13, and waits for secondary crushing after discharge. When the screen 10 needs to be cleaned, the sealing door 17 can be opened first, then the two bolts 15 can be unscrewed, and finally the limiting plate 9 can be removed from the buffer column 14, and then the vibration plate 7 can be removed from the crushing box. Take out the notch of 1, and then the screen 10 can be cleaned.
